What is a Bluetooth Microphone?

A Bluetooth microphone is a wireless audio input device that uses Bluetooth technology to transmit sound signals to a receiver—typically a smartphone, tablet, computer, or camera. Unlike traditional microphones that rely on wired connections or radio frequencies, Bluetooth microphones leverage the standard 2.4 GHz Bluetooth protocol to offer wireless functionality.

These microphones often come with built-in batteries, digital signal processors, and simplified connectivity options. Bluetooth microphones are designed for ease of use, especially in environments where mobility, speed, and convenience are critical.

How Bluetooth Microphones Work

The operation of a Bluetooth microphone is based on the same principle as other Bluetooth-enabled devices. The microphone captures analog audio signals through its internal diaphragm. These signals are then converted into digital format using an analog-to-digital converter. Once converted, the digital audio is transmitted via a Bluetooth module to a paired device.

The receiving device then decodes the signal, processes it, and either stores the audio or transmits it for live use, depending on the application. Most Bluetooth microphones support standard Bluetooth audio codecs, such as SBC, AAC, or aptX, to ensure efficient compression and transmission.

Types of Bluetooth Microphones

Bluetooth microphones come in a range of styles to meet different needs. The most common types include:

  1. Handheld Bluetooth Microphones
    These resemble traditional mics and are often used for karaoke, public speaking, and mobile interviews. They typically have built-in speakers and control buttons.

  2. Lavalier (Clip-on) Bluetooth Microphones
    Designed for hands-free use, these clip-on microphones are favored by content creators, educators, and presenters who need mobility.

  3. Headset Bluetooth Microphones
    Integrated into headsets, these are ideal for gaming, online meetings, or voice-over work.

  4. Desktop Bluetooth Microphones
    These are stationary units suited for podcasting, webinars, and professional voice recording.

  5. Smartphone-Compatible Microphones
    These compact microphones are designed specifically to pair with mobile phones for high-quality vlogging or live streaming.

Limitations and Considerations

Despite their benefits, Bluetooth microphones also have some limitations that users should consider:

  • Latency: Because of signal compression and transmission time, there can be slight delays between speaking and audio reception. This can be noticeable in live performance or video production.

  • Audio Quality: While good enough for many applications, Bluetooth audio may not match the fidelity of professional-grade microphones using XLR connections or digital interfaces.

  • Range: Bluetooth devices typically have a limited operational range—usually around 10 meters—depending on the environment and device class.

  • Battery Dependency: These microphones require regular charging, and battery life can vary significantly based on usage and model.

  • Interference: Bluetooth signals may suffer interference in crowded environments with multiple wireless devices.

Features to Look for When Buying a Bluetooth Microphone

Choosing the right Bluetooth microphone depends on individual needs and preferences. Key features to evaluate include:

  • Battery Life: Look for a microphone that offers several hours of continuous use on a single charge.

  • Microphone Type: Choose between omnidirectional and unidirectional mics based on your recording environment.

  • Build Quality: Durable, ergonomic design is important for frequent use and travel.

  • Bluetooth Version: Newer Bluetooth versions generally offer better range and lower latency.

  • Audio Enhancements: Features like noise cancellation, echo reduction, and gain control can improve sound quality.

  • Device Compatibility: Confirm whether the microphone works seamlessly with your preferred operating system and apps.

Future of Bluetooth Microphones

The future of Bluetooth microphones looks promising, driven by advancements in Bluetooth technology, battery efficiency, and digital signal processing. Developments such as Bluetooth Low Energy (LE Audio), improved codecs, and AI-based audio enhancements are setting new standards in wireless audio capture.

Manufacturers are increasingly focusing on hybrid models that combine Bluetooth connectivity with backup local storage, noise isolation, and compatibility with professional recording gear. This trend indicates that Bluetooth microphones are transitioning from casual tools to more serious production equipment.

FAQs

1. What is the difference between a Bluetooth microphone and a traditional wireless microphone?
A Bluetooth microphone uses Bluetooth protocol to transmit sound directly to paired devices like smartphones or computers. Traditional wireless microphones use dedicated radio frequencies and typically require a separate receiver.

2. Can I use a Bluetooth microphone for professional recording?
While some high-end Bluetooth microphones offer decent quality, professional studios still prefer wired or RF-based microphones for optimal sound fidelity and lower latency.

3. Are Bluetooth microphones compatible with all smartphones?
Most Bluetooth microphones are compatible with modern Android and iOS smartphones, provided the devices support Bluetooth audio profiles. However, certain features may vary depending on the operating system.

4. How far can I be from my device when using a Bluetooth microphone?
Typical Bluetooth microphones work reliably within a 10-meter range. However, obstacles like walls and interference can affect this range.
